CVE-2016-5853
Qualcomm Android Audio Driver - Improper Error Handling Vulnerability
Description

In an audio driver in all Qualcomm products with Android releases from CAF using the Linux kernel, when a sanity check encounters a length value not in the correct range, an error message is printed, but code execution continues in the same way as for a correct length value.
